Original Description
Van Gogh’s Uitgebloeide zonnebloemen (Faded Sunflowers) is a poignant meditation on decay and renewal, painted in 1887 during his Paris period. Unlike the vibrant, iconic Sunflowers of Arles, these blossoms are wilted, their petals drooping in muted ochres and browns against a softly blurred background. The brushwork is looser, infused with the influence of Impressionism, yet unmistakably Van Gogh in its emotive intensity. This lesser-known work reveals his fascination with transience—a theme echoing Dutch still-life traditions while subverting them with raw, expressive strokes. Art historically, it bridges his early somber palette and the explosive color of later works, offering a quiet counterpoint to his more celebrated floral studies. The painting’s introspective mood and textured surface invite viewers to contemplate beauty in impermanence.
